The custom flyouts tag on WindowsForum.com covers discussions about replacing or enhancing Windows system flyouts, such as the volume, brightness, and network pop-ups, with third-party alternatives. In the context of Seelen UI, a web-first desktop environment for Windows 11, custom flyouts are part of a broader effort to reimagine the user interface. Users explore how these flyouts can be tailored for better functionality and aesthetics, often as components of larger customization suites. The tag focuses on practical modifications that improve the Windows experience without relying on default system controls.
